Sarah Osvath

Sarah Osvath (born 25 July 1963) is an Australian fencer.

She competed in the women's épée event at the 1996 Summer Olympics.

[1][2] Having retired from international fencing in 2001, Osvath now works as a research assistant at the University of Technology Sydney's ithree Institute.
